New signings

The most anticipated new transfer of Manchester United may be Paris Saint-Germain’s Manuel Ugarte. He is the latest Manchester United new player transfer, singing for £50m plus £10m in add-ons.

Ugarte is the fifth signing under Erik Ten Hag, following 18-year-old Leny Yoro, striker Joshua Zirkzee, Matthijs de Ligt, and full-back Noussair Mazraou. The thought is that each new transfer of Manchester United is entering their peak years and can help bring the club back to glory.

The team spared no expense, paying more than £200m for their new additions. Yoro is the most costly of the group, coming with a £62m fee to bring him over from the French Ligue 1.

Impact of the changes

Whether the most impactful Manchester United new player transfer will be Ugarte or Yoro (or another player) remains to be seen. Ugarte is considered to be one of the best midfielders in the game. He also becomes the second senior holding player next to the returning Casemiro.

The signing of Yoro is a major one for a few reasons. It not only signifies changes to the team’s recruitment policy but is the first time that the club has beaten a major rival to a bright, talented young player. Both Paris Saint-German and Real Madrid both pursued the young star and Yoro even expressed a preference for Madrid before ultimately signing on with United.

United has managed to sign a lot of quality young talent in recent years. Rasmus Hojlund, Antony, and Jadon Sancho all garnered major deals despite there being a lack of major competition for their services. This will be a make-or-break season for both Ten Hag and the club. With the addition of quality players like Yoro and Ugarte, there will be no excuses now. A championship may not be realistic, but a finish in the top four could very well happen.
